Transaction 104456b98054328aef85e179a9ece1dfd731dbfcc19dc3514efe4c3f0953a7b6
1 Input
1 Output
-
104456b98054328aef85e179a9ece1dfd731dbfcc19dc3514efe4c3f0953a7b6:0
- value
- 30092
- script pubkey
- OP_0 OP_PUSHBYTES_20 e768f837bf24fd3248c2c4e66a16dc64f4da5201
- address
- bc1qua50sdalyn7nyjxzcnnx59kuvn6d55sp4gj3tr